2462 - 第k个素数

题目描述

请求出 1-n 的范围中,第 k 小的素数。

本题有 q 次询问,请针对每次询问输出第 k 小的素数。

输入

1 行输出两个正整数 n,q,表示查询范围及查询的次数。

接下来 q 行,每行有一个正整数 k ,表示查询第 k 小的素数。

10≤n≤108 , 1≤q≤105, 样例数据保证第k个素数一定在n的范围内存在。

输出

输出 q 行,输出每次询问的结果。

样例

输入

100 5
12
5
8
9
6

输出

37
11
19
23
13
标签
题目参数
时间限制 1 秒
内存限制 512 MB
提交次数 543
通过人数 119
金币数量 1 枚
难度 入门


上一题 下一题